SONDER BROADCASTING
What is Sonder?
A private voice platform for recording, preserving, and sharing your stories

Sonder is a voice-first platform for recording, organising, and preserving the stories that make a life.

It is a place for memories, reflections, family history, turning points, small moments, and the thoughts that deserve more than a passing message.

The name comes from the word sonder: the realisation that every person around you is living a life as vivid, complex, and full as your own. That idea sits at the heart of the platform. Sonder was built for the stories we carry, the ones we inherit, and the ones we may one day leave behind.

It is not built around performance, followers, or public popularity. You choose what stays private, what is shared with people you trust, and what is made available to the wider community.

The Four Spaces
How the app is laid out and what each area does
  • Sonder — your private studio. This is where you record, edit, and organise everything. Your Library lives here, along with your Journal. Everything in this space is yours alone unless you choose to share it
  • Stream — the public listening space. Members who choose to publish their recordings appear here. You can discover new voices, follow people whose stories resonate with you, and browse by theme — all without any pressure to perform or comment
  • Kin — your people. This is where you connect with specific individuals, exchange voice messages and text through the built-in Messages centre, and access heritage tools for preserving and organising family stories across generations
  • Community — shared storytelling. A space for community announcements, responding to shared prompts, and discovering voices on collective themes. Optional, never required
Recording & Editing
How to make a Sonder and what you can do with it afterwards
  • What is a Sonder? A Sonder is a voice recording you make — a story, a memory, a reflection, a thought. Each one is stored privately in your Library until you decide what to do with it
  • How do I record? Tap the microphone button to start. You can speak freely, or choose a prompt — Daily Sparks arrive each day, Reflect prompts are tied to specific events. Both are optional. There is no set time limit — longer recordings are automatically split into segments
  • How do I save? When you finish recording, you can give it a title, add tags, and save it to your Library. Try to record in one session without closing the app — if the app closes mid-recording, the in-progress audio has not yet been saved
  • What can I edit? Open any saved Sonder in the built-in waveform editor to trim, cut, or rearrange sections of your audio. You can also read and edit the auto-generated transcript separately — correct words, tidy phrasing, or remove sections from the text
Your Library
Everything you've recorded, organised your way
  • Your Library is your personal archive — everything you record lives here, visible only to you unless you share it
  • Two tabs keep things separate: Sonders for your voice recordings, and Journal for written entries — each with its own space and search
  • Smart collections are created automatically: Daily Sparks responses, Favourites, Inspiration saves, Community Responses, and Reflect Responses — so your recordings are grouped without any effort from you
  • You can also build your own structure: create Albums to group recordings by theme, chapter, or person, then gather albums into Collections for broader projects. There is no limit on how many you create
  • Download any Sonder as an MP3, or export a full album or collection as a ZIP file with audio and transcripts included
The Stream
Discover and listen to voices from the wider Sonder community
  • The Stream is where members who have chosen to publish their recordings can be heard. Publishing is always a deliberate choice — nothing appears here by accident
  • Browse by category, filter by theme, or let the platform surface voices you haven't found yet. There is no requirement to comment, react publicly, or perform engagement of any kind
  • Follow people whose voices you want to return to — their published recordings appear in your Following feed
  • Mark recordings with Resonance to note stories that moved you. Resonance counts are never shown publicly — other members cannot see what you have resonated with, and any counts on your own stories are visible only to you in your private settings
Kin
Your connections, your messages, your family legacy
  • Kin is where you build your inner circle on Sonder. All connections are mutual and consent-based — you send a request, they accept. No one is added without agreement
  • Once connected, you can share Sonders directly with specific people, receive voice messages and recordings they send just for you, and have private conversations through the built-in Messages centre
  • The Messages centre supports text, voice messages, photos, and video — a full private channel between you and each person in your Kin
  • Legacy Collections let you create curated archives of recordings for your family — organised by theme, relationship, or generation — and share them with the specific people who matter most
  • If you remove a connection, they immediately lose access to anything you had shared with them privately
Privacy
Your story. Your rules. Your data.
  • Every Sonder is private by default. Nothing is ever shared without a deliberate action from you
  • Each recording has its own privacy setting — keep it private, share it with specific Kin, or publish it to the Stream. You can change this at any time
  • Your Kin are automatically blocked from hearing anything you publish to the Stream. This is intentional — it keeps your private relationships and your public voice completely separate
  • Your recordings belong to you. Download any Sonder as an MP3, export a full collection as a ZIP, or request a complete account export at any time — audio, transcripts, and a readable index
  • Sonder does not use your recordings for advertising and does not sell your data. Ever. You can request full account deletion at any time — access continues to your billing period end, then everything is permanently removed
Plans & Access
What it costs, what you get, and how to join
  • Sonder is subscription-based — no ads, no data selling, no algorithm chasing engagement. The platform is funded by the people who use it
  • Seed (A$10/month) — unlimited private recording, Library organisation, Stream listening, Kin connections, messaging, and community access
  • Legacy (A$18/month) — everything in Seed, plus AI transcription, publishing to the Stream, Explore access, full Family Tree editing, and Legacy Collection tools for heritage archiving
  • You can gift a subscription to someone else — delivered by email, claimed when they are ready, with optional scheduling for a future date
  • If you cancel, access continues until the end of your billing period. You will not be charged again
